Jurpania Population - Giridih, Jharkhand
Jurpania is a medium size village located in Bengabad Block of Giridih district, Jharkhand with total 95 families residing. The Jurpania village has population of 546 of which 284 are males while 262 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Jurpania village population of children with age 0-6 is 101 which makes up 18.50 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Jurpania village is 923 which is lower than Jharkhand state average of 948. Child Sex Ratio for the Jurpania as per census is 1104, higher than Jharkhand average of 948.
Jurpania village has lower literacy rate compared to Jharkhand. In 2011, literacy rate of Jurpania village was 58.43 % compared to 66.41 % of Jharkhand. In Jurpania Male literacy stands at 70.34 % while female literacy rate was 44.98 %.

Jurpania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 95 | - | - |
Population | 546 | 284 | 262 |
Child (0-6) | 101 | 48 | 53 |
Schedule Caste | 0 | 0 | 0 |
Schedule Tribe | 351 | 184 | 167 |
Literacy | 58.43 % | 70.34 % | 44.98 % |
Total Workers | 306 | 165 | 141 |
Main Worker | 75 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 231 | 119 | 112 |
